Engineering is a field that requires a solid understanding of mathematics, science, and problem-solving skills. It is a highly competitive and challenging profession that demands rigorous training and education. For students who may not have the necessary academic background or prerequisites to directly enter an engineering program, an engineering foundation year can be a crucial stepping stone towards achieving their academic and career goals.

An engineering foundation year is a preparatory program designed to provide students with the fundamental knowledge and skills they need to succeed in an engineering degree program. It typically covers a range of subjects such as mathematics, physics, chemistry, and computer science, as well as important engineering concepts and principles. The goal of the foundation year is to help students develop a strong academic foundation and build the necessary skills to excel in their future engineering studies.

One of the key benefits of an engineering foundation year is that it helps students bridge the gap between their current academic level and the requirements of an engineering program. For students who may have struggled with certain subjects in high school or who did not take the necessary courses to prepare for an engineering degree, the foundation year can provide them with the opportunity to catch up and build a solid foundation for their future studies. By taking courses in subjects like calculus, physics, and chemistry, students can develop the necessary knowledge and skills to succeed in their engineering courses.

In addition to academic preparation, an engineering foundation year also helps students develop important problem-solving and critical thinking skills that are essential for success in the field of engineering. Through hands-on projects, laboratory work, and group assignments, students are able to apply their knowledge to real-world problems and gain practical experience in solving engineering challenges. This hands-on approach not only helps students develop their technical skills but also fosters teamwork, communication, and collaboration – all of which are important skills for engineers in the workplace.

Furthermore, an engineering foundation year can also help students explore different areas of engineering and determine their areas of interest and specialization. By taking introductory courses in various engineering disciplines, students can gain a better understanding of the different branches of engineering and decide which field they are most passionate about. This can help students make informed decisions about their future career path and choose a specialization that aligns with their interests and goals.

Another important aspect of an engineering foundation year is that it can improve students’ confidence and motivation. For students who may have struggled academically in the past or who may feel intimidated by the rigors of an engineering program, the foundation year can provide them with the support and encouragement they need to succeed. By building a strong academic foundation and gaining hands-on experience, students can boost their confidence and develop a positive attitude towards their studies. This can help them overcome any doubts or insecurities they may have and empower them to tackle the challenges of an engineering program with confidence and determination.

In conclusion, an engineering foundation year is a valuable opportunity for students who are looking to pursue a career in engineering but may not have the necessary academic background or prerequisites to directly enter an engineering program. By providing students with the fundamental knowledge, skills, and confidence they need to succeed in their future studies, the foundation year can serve as a crucial stepping stone towards achieving academic success and realizing their career goals.
